    MyMichigan Medical Center Saginaw (formerly Ascension St. Mary's Hospital, formerly St. Mary's of Michigan Medical Center) is a hospital in Saginaw, Michigan, United States. MyMichigan Medical Center Saginaw is certified as a Comprehensive Stroke Center by The Joint Commission.

    Ascension Michigan, formerly St. John Providence Health System and the St. John Health System, is the Michigan division of Ascension Health.. It was its own non-profit corporation that owned and operated four hospitals and over 125 medical facilities in the U.S. state of Michigan.

    St. Joseph's Hospital was founded in 1853 in Saint Paul, Minnesota as Minnesota's first hospital. [4] The Sisters of St. Joseph of Carondelet founded the facility in response to the outbreak of cholera in the community. [5] [6] [3] St. Joseph's Hospital became one of the founding members of the HealthEast Care System when it was created in 1986.
